How are mangosteen and brunost different?

  • Brunost is higher than mangosteen in vitamin B2, vitamin B1,2, vitamin B5, phosphorus, potassium, calcium, vitamin B1, and vitamin A.
  • Brunost covers your daily need for vitamin B2, 102% more than mangosteen.
  • Mangosteen is lower in sodium.
  • Mangosteen has a higher glycemic index (58) than brunost (27).

Mangosteen, canned, syrup pack and Cheese, gjetost types were used in this article.
